Chow, Li and Yi in [2] proved that the majority of the unperturbed tori {\it on sub-manifolds} will persist for standard Hamiltonian systems. Motivated by their work, in this paper, we study the persistence and tangent frequencies preservation of lower dimensional invariant tori on smooth sub-manifolds for real analytic, nearly integrable Hamiltonian systems. The surviving tori might be elliptic, hyperbolic, or of mixed type.
